Output d21b65bd7cbd97c6f10fad58faaef5c84da270583186f7cf149a3c32ced19e04:1

value
14663322406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2eb15b69ae3d2bbac92f26652b5e70a188eb70 OP_EQUAL
address
3ENwnUqvogRKtJGUpmxHKHB8edQb7LJrQc
transaction
d21b65bd7cbd97c6f10fad58faaef5c84da270583186f7cf149a3c32ced19e04
spent
true